Investigation of fluid-structure interactions (FSI) in a radial blade cascade subject to forced excitation.
The work focuses on the study of the interaction between flowing water and blades in a fix-radial cascade configuration, as representation of a high-head Francis turbine. The research involves both experimental and numerical studies. Experiments will provide essential results to validate the numerical model of multiphysics. PIV measurements tecniques are performed toghether with CFD and FEM analysis.
